Load tests against the Cartwheel checkout flow run only in the Bramblewood staging cluster, never production. Traffic is generated by the Stampede harness, capped at 500 requests per second. All synthetic orders use the test tender type, so no settlement occurs. Stampede authenticates to the internal metrics collector, Tallyhook, using the service key provided below.

service key, yadug-bajog: zpat3_pou

Step 6 — configure PickPilot. The pick-list optimizer for the Drayford warehouse reads its routing weights from `weights/prod.toml`; verify the checksum matches the release manifest before proceeding. Then confirm the optimizer can reach the slotting database in read-only mode. Finally, open `.env.production` and append the slotting database credential immediately after this sentence.

vault entry, kafog-yahop: COURIER_KEY8=0faa53ae

FAQ: What if I'm locked out of the Hueledger audit workspace?

Contractors running the color-contrast audit for the Marrowgate redesign sometimes lose access after the weekly permission sweep. Don't create a new account; that breaks audit attribution. Instead, open the Hueledger recovery prompt, confirm your assigned component list, and enter the team passphrase printed directly beneath this answer.

unlock words, bagug-kadup: wenath-zorael

Onboarding note for the Ledgerpane admin table: bulk edits are applied through the batcher service, not directly against the database. Select rows, choose an action, and the batcher stages changes in a pending set you can review before commit. Edits over 500 rows require a second approver — this is enforced server-side, so don't try to chunk around it. To run the batcher locally you need the staging write credential, which goes in your .env as the next line.

secret setting of bahip-kagag: RELAY_SECRET3=c83